## What is the Architecture of Decentralized Protocol Coupling?

Decentralized Protocol Coupling describes the interconnectedness and dependencies between distinct, independently governed protocols within a cryptocurrency ecosystem, particularly relevant in the context of options trading and derivatives. This coupling manifests through shared data feeds, cross-protocol collateralization, or the programmatic interaction of smart contracts across different chains. Understanding these architectural linkages is crucial for assessing systemic risk, as failures in one protocol can propagate rapidly through the network, impacting related instruments and positions. Effective design mitigates this risk through modularity and clearly defined interfaces, promoting resilience and isolating potential vulnerabilities.

## What is the Algorithm of Decentralized Protocol Coupling?

The algorithmic aspects of Decentralized Protocol Coupling involve the automated execution of strategies that leverage interactions between protocols. For instance, a trading bot might dynamically adjust its options positions based on price movements across multiple underlying assets managed by different protocols. Sophisticated algorithms can also facilitate cross-chain arbitrage opportunities, exploiting temporary price discrepancies between protocols. However, these algorithmic interactions introduce complexity, requiring careful consideration of latency, oracle reliability, and potential feedback loops that could destabilize the system.

## What is the Risk of Decentralized Protocol Coupling?

Decentralized Protocol Coupling amplifies systemic risk within the cryptocurrency derivatives space. Interdependencies create pathways for contagion, where a vulnerability in one protocol can cascade through the entire network, impacting options pricing, collateral requirements, and overall market stability. Quantifying this risk necessitates advanced modeling techniques that account for the dynamic nature of protocol interactions and the potential for unforeseen correlations. Robust risk management frameworks must incorporate stress testing and scenario analysis to evaluate the resilience of coupled protocols under adverse market conditions.
